Output 380024c39261650f6707026be15ac8c3c982bd9b46ed1389c2ca1fc7751a057a:2

value
28806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0377272a12748ecf41b7c7b8622ec9e7bb472a11 OP_EQUAL
address
321Lh1knNRVBu3LXrnHzN5rWX6vPcyw86x
transaction
380024c39261650f6707026be15ac8c3c982bd9b46ed1389c2ca1fc7751a057a
spent
true